Market Equity is regulated by Labuan FSA, making it much safer than unregulated brokers. The license type is STP and the license number is MB/21/0083. It regulates VFSC and ASIC with a suspicious clone status.

Market Equity provides ECN, Money Back, and Scalping accounts. Traders who want low spreads can choose an ECN account, and those who want low leverage can choose a scalping account.
The Multi Account Manager account provides the opportunity for professional traders to manage sub-client accounts through the main account trading Terminal simultaneously. In addition, the demo account is predominantly used for familiarizing traders with the trading platform and for educational purposes only.
Account Type | ECN | Money Back | Scalping |
Minimum deposit | $100 | $100 | $100 |
Spreads | From 0.0 | From 1.4 | From 1.4 |
Leverage | Up to 1:500 | Up to 1:500 | Up to 1:200 |
Minimum lot size | 0.01 | 0.01 | 0.01 |
Commission | $8 | 0 | 0 |
Free Swap | Yes | Yes | - |
The spread is as low as 0.0, opening ECN and Money Back accounts can enjoy swap-free, and the minimum commission is from 0. The lower the spread, the faster the liquidity.
The maximum leverage is 1:500 meaning that profits and losses are magnified 500 times.

The minimum deposit is $100. Market Equity accepts Visa, MasterCard, Sticpay, Neteller, Skrill, Fasapay, etc. for deposit and withdrawal. The timing of the transfer process can be processed between one to two working days.
